Amber Balcaen is a Canadian race car driver known for her participation in various racing series, including the ARCA Menards Series. Born on March 25, 1991, she has developed a reputation for her talent and determination on the track. Balcaen has made significant strides in a male-dominated sport, showcasing her skills and passion for racing. Although she did not compete in the Daytona 500, she recently expressed her excitement about President Donald Trump's attendance at the event, stating that his presence added an electrifying atmosphere to the race. Her experiences in racing and her insights into the sport have made her a notable figure in the motorsports community.
